Output 251f7a06a1a30374789110e03db99e712c7f5bc239c98deb4da7d6cc44eaeda3:11

value
42613256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ae30747387ccf39863fbfbda3ac21ecc58d1aabc OP_EQUAL
address
MPnBrWj2tcBDdxCfGWKMnWaNu6fc3N2paj
transaction
251f7a06a1a30374789110e03db99e712c7f5bc239c98deb4da7d6cc44eaeda3
spent
true